MOOCs and Open Education Around the World.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.

MOOCs and Open Education is a
edited collection
which
reviews
subjects
relating to open
educational resources
and
massive open online courses.
Recent
advancements in
distance learning technology have provided the means for
learners
all around the world
to participate in online classes.
These massive online courses are
usually free
for learners but do not
always
lead to formal accreditation.
